I love the new floral roses in the new release, and couldn't resist gold embossing them.  

I created a panel from creamy white card stock, using FineTec Artist Mica Watercolors in shimmery golds.  When dry, I gold embossed the Ginko Spray, and painted it with golds from the FineTec Artist Mica Watercolors set.  I wish you could see the shimmery goldness in these leaves in real life!

I also embossed the Just Rosy and Fairy Rose images, and painted them with the white pearl FineTec Artist Mica Watercolors.  I fussy-cut the flowers, and added them to the card front.  

I white embossed the Hug Your Blessings verse onto a scrap of gold card stock, and added that.

That's all there is to it!  These shimmery FineTec paints really bring the coloring to a new level of shimmery goodness!
